CentOS系统究竟有何独特之处?探索这款操作系统的奥秘
- 行业动态
- 2024-10-06
- 1
CentOS是一个基于Linux的开源操作系统,主要用于服务器和云计算环境。
CentOS(Community Enterprise Operating System)是一个基于Red Hat Enterprise Linux (RHEL) 源代码构建的免费、开源的企业级操作系统,它提供了与RHEL高度兼容的功能,但不需要支付任何费用,以下是对CentOS的具体介绍:
CentOS系统
项目 | 描述 |
名称 | Community Enterprise Operating System,社区企业操作系统 |
起源 | 由Red Hat Enterprise Linux依照开放源代码编译而成 |
发布周期 | 每两年发行一次新版本,每个版本提供十年的安全维护支持 |
主要特点 | 稳定性高、完全开源免费、提供长期支持和丰富的软件包 |
CentOS的版本分类
1. CentOS Linux版
版本 | 描述 |
CentOS 7 | 提供长期稳定支持,适合生产环境使用 |
CentOS 8 | 已于2021年底结束支持,不再推荐使用 |
2. CentOS Stream版
版本 | 描述 |
CentOS Stream 8 | 滚动更新版,适合追求最新特性和早期试用的用户 |
CentOS Stream 9 | 继续作为RHEL开发分支的上游,提供最新的功能和改进 |
CentOS系统安装方式
1. DVD安装
准备:将刻录好的光盘放入服务器光盘驱动器,从CD-ROM引导。
步骤:选择语言 -> 键盘配置 -> 鼠标配置 -> 安装类型(服务器) -> 磁盘分区设置(建议自动分区) -> Bootloader配置 -> 网络配置(手动设置IP和掩码) -> 防火墙配置(无防火墙) -> 设置密码 -> 选择包组 -> 开始安装。
时间:安装过程需要30-60分钟。
2. U盘安装
准备:使用UltraISO等工具将CentOS ISO镜像写入U盘。
步骤:重启计算机并从U盘启动 -> 选择“安装或升级现有系统” -> 语言选择 -> 键盘模式 -> 安装方法(硬盘) -> 选择U盘所在的分区 -> 设置网络和主机名 -> 设置root密码 -> 创建用户账户(可选) -> 选择安装的软件包组 -> 开始安装。
注意事项:确保U盘格式化正确,并保留必要的文件夹。
CentOS的特点
1、稳定性与可靠性:CentOS严格遵循上游RHEL的源代码,经过严格的测试以保证其稳定性,适用于长期运行的服务环境,如Web服务器、数据库服务器、邮件服务器等。
2、开源免费:作为RHEL的克隆版本,CentOS完全免费,且提供完整的源代码,用户可以自由下载、使用和分发,无需支付任何费用。
3、企业级支持:尽管CentOS本身不提供商业支持,但由于其与RHEL的高度兼容性,许多第三方服务提供商提供针对CentOS的技术支持和咨询服务。
4、生命周期长:CentOS提供了长期支持(LTS)版本,每个版本的维护周期长达数年,确保了软件更新和安全补丁的持续供应,降低了频繁升级带来的运维成本。
5、丰富的软件包:CentOS使用Yum(或较新版本的DNF)作为包管理器,通过官方仓库或第三方仓库(如EPEL)提供了大量的软件包,便于安装、升级和管理各种应用程序。
6、社区支持:CentOS拥有活跃的用户社区和开发者社区,用户可以在社区论坛、邮件列表或社交媒体平台上寻求帮助、交流经验,同时也有大量的教程、文档和工具可供参考。
相关问题与解答
1、问题一:CentOS与Red Hat Enterprise Linux (RHEL) 有什么区别?
答案:CentOS是基于RHEL源代码重新编译而成的,两者在功能上高度兼容,主要区别在于CentOS是免费的,而RHEL是付费的商业发行版,CentOS不包含封闭的源代码软件,并且主要由社区提供支持。
2、问题二:为什么CentOS会有两个主要版本(Linux版和Stream版)?
答案:CentOS Linux版提供传统的稳定版本,每个版本有固定的生命周期和定期的安全更新,CentOS Stream版则是滚动更新版,没有固定版本号,是动态更新具体的内容,适合追求最新特性和早期试用的用户,这种区分使得用户可以根据需求选择合适的版本。
以上内容就是解答有关“CentOS是什么系统?CentOS系统介绍”的详细内容了,我相信这篇文章可以为您解决一些疑惑,有任何问题欢迎留言反馈,谢谢阅读。
本站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本站,有问题联系侵删!
本文链接:http://www.xixizhuji.com/fuzhu/31620.html